This is based on a traditional Portuguese soup that uses Chorizo. We use a package of ground turkey, seasoned with Penzey’s Italian Sausage Seasoning. Vegetarian Chorizo would work, if you don’t want to use the pork stuff. Amounts are rough, but if you are a stickler for measurements, try this version at Epicurious.com. In a [...]

Thank goodness for leftover Rosh Hashanah turkey and Cooking Light Magazine, November 2008: Turkey curry Cranberry-mango Chutney: combine 3/4 cup mango chutney (Major Grey), 1/4 cup whole-berry cranberry sauce, 1/4 cup finely chopped Granny Smith apple. Stir and serve. Brown rice (steamed, not boil in bag seen in recipe) Steamed Cauliflower
